QUICK TAKE ON THE MARKETS:
EQUITIES: Higher for the week. We are sticking to our Trade Triangle analysis and we have an upside target of $1,550 on the S&P 500 sometime next year.
CRUDE OIL: Lower for the week. Mixed trend picture, while the long-term trend is positive for crude, the intermediate-term trend remains negative based on our Trade Triangle technology.
EURO: Higher for the week. All Trade Triangles are green and are bullish for the Euro.
GOLD: Higher for the week. All Trade Triangles are green and are bullish on gold.
COPPER: Higher for the week. All Trade Triangles are green and are bullish on copper.
SILVER:Higher for the week. All Trade Triangles are green and are bullish on silver.
WILD CARDS: The general election, "the Fiscal Cliff", Europe, Syria, and Turkey.
